Playing With Friends
If I want to play with a specific person, is there a way to do that? There is no private servers, no IP's, no way to invite a friend, and no way to pick who you play with. I LOVE the game and my friend bought it, but I have no idea how we could play online together. Can someone help? :steamhappy:

It's pretty simple, ask your friend to go to the server browser. After your friend is in the server browser it's your turn. Simply click play, then click "Enable multiplayer" on the top right. You can set the player limit to 2 if you don't want to be disturbed. After you do this start your game. Once the game is up ask your friend to click the refresh button in the server browser. When they refresh they should see your server (the server name will just be your steam name) and will be able to join it. If they dont see your server just have them wait for a minute and resfrsh the server list again. Hope this helps.
